  • It's time for some faith fuel

    Hebrews 11:6 says, But without faith, it is impossible to please Him, for he who comes to God must believe that He is and that He is a rewarder of those who diligently seek Him. Faith is a necessity, not only in pleasing God but also in obtaining His promises. Without faith, we have nothing. Everything in God’s world requires our faith, from receiving Him as Lord and Saviour to believing that every need is met. Sometimes we find our faith wavering, especially if we have had a long battle that has gone on for some time. It's hard to believe during those times. Faith acts as a barrier between us and the trials we face. We cannot afford to neglect our faith, and if it is wavering, we must repair it as soon as possible. How do we increase our faith? Romans 10:17 says, So then faith comes by hearing and hearing by the word of God. Consistent exposure to the Word of God through hearing, reading, and meditation is necessary for faith to grow. The greater our immersion in the Word of God, the more our faith will flourish. As our faith grows, so does what we receive from God. I have learned in my life that when my faith is not where it needs to be, it's time to increase my Word intake and build it up again. Get my confidence back on track, knowing God is able. Staying in the Word daily and feeding my faith helps me stay strong and assured that God is with me. If a problem looks too big, increase your Word intake until the situation stops overwhelming you. You can only believe in what you are confident God can do for you. If you feel anxious, it's time for some faith fuel. You can never overdose on God’s Word. The more of it you have the better things will be for you. Now that’s something to get busy doing.

  • Panic Attacks Help!

    When experiencing a panic attack, it's recommended to soothe oneself by concentrating on taking deep breaths. Inhale deeply and count to four, then hold your breath for seven counts before exhaling slowly for a count of eight. The purpose is to shift your focus from panicking thoughts to counting. Well, I think we can take this exercise up a notch. Inhale deeply and repeat the phrase, "Jesus loves me. " Hold your breath and repeat the following phrase, "I entrust this concern to Him, knowing that He cares for me." With a deep exhale, whisper, "Thank you, Jesus. I trust you to handle my problem." Jesus is the only one that can calm your storm. If you connect to Him when anxiety rises, it can quickly calm down your troubled thoughts. We were never promised a life without trials and problems. But He has promised us that if we keep our minds on Him, He will surround us with His peace. You can go through a storm, but in you, is a peace you cannot explain. Knowing who our God is and that He takes care of everything that comes our way should give us hope and relief. You will never do life alone. There will never be a situation that God cannot help you with. So if you feel a panic attack coming, practice speaking to it while you do your breathing exercises. I know for a fact that Jesus will calm your anxious mind down and give you peace. Anxiety Scriptures Philippians 4: 4-8 Isa. 6:1-3 Hebrew 13:8 Lam.3:17-20

  • Do you have an overwhelming dream?

    Do you have a dream that overwhelms you? Not knowing how or if it ever will happen? Well, let me encourage you today. Mary–Jesus' mother found herself in the same boat. Out of the blue, an angel appears to her to tell her she will conceive by the Holy Spirit and give birth to a son, Jesus, who will be called the Son of the Most High. We can only imagine the confusion and how disturbed Mary was at hearing this news. Yes, she was obedient to receive what was promised to her, but being a virgin and pregnant certainly had its problems, especially in those times. She must have worried about how she was going to explain this to her parents and to Joseph her fiance. Who would believe her? Even today, people still do not believe it. Mary decided to visit her aunt Elizabeth. She probably had a good relationship with her and felt comfortable sharing her news. I'm sure on her journey to Elizabeth she would have rehearsed how she would explain her situation. Fear would have been knocking on her door continuously, telling her Elizabeth would reject her. As scripture tells us, the moment Elizabeth saw Mary, the child in her womb jumped–John, Jesus' forerunner and Elizabeth was filled with the Holy Spirit and prophesied over Mary. God went ahead of Mary and prepared the way for her. They had a wonderful few months of fellowship rejoicing in the upcoming events. God went ahead of Jesus and prepared the way for His ministry by sending John six months ahead of Him. Even when Mary returned home, Joseph had received instructions from God to marry Mary still and that her pregnancy was a gift from God. God prepared his heart to stay with Mary. No matter how impossible your dreams seem, God is going ahead of you, preparing the way. We know God provided for Jesus from the moment He was born through the wise men who brought gifts for Him. If God has given you the desire to do something amazing for Him, rest in it because He is able. He can move mountains. He can meet your every need. Let Him lead and guide you every step of the way, as Mary did. God will connect you with the correct people that are waiting for you. Don’t let go of your dreams. Someone is waiting on the other side of your obedience. Take the first step by being obedient and God will lead you to the next one. It's not for us to know the how. We are to trust and obey using our faith every step of the way. It is called Pro-Vision. God sees ahead what you need and provides the supply before you ever know that you need it. God can take care of you! Scripture References: Luke 1: 26-56 Ephesians 3:16
